Briar Cliff University Department of Nursing has three options to attain the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) degree:

  • BASIC BSN OPTION: Students who are
    not already registered nurses may elect
    to enroll at Briar Cliff for the entire
    four-year basic BSN program leading to
    eligibility to take the registered nursing
    licensure exam (NCLEX-RN).

  • L.P.N.-B.S.N. OPTION: L.P.N.s with an active license can pursue a program of studies leading to a B.S.N. and complete it within three additional years.

  • R.N.-B.S.N. OPTION: Registered nurses
    may pursue a program of studies leading to a B.S.N. 

With each option the nursing major is directed toward:

  1. fostering wholistic personal and professional development
  2. preparing nurses who engage in reflective practice related to health and quality of life in a variety of health care settings
  3. developing nurses who participate in ethical decision making related to health and quality of life
  4. providing a foundation for critical thinking and for the development, integration, and evaluation of new or expanded knowledge into practice
  5. providing a foundation for continued learning, and for graduate and post-graduate education in nursing
